"It's just like camping without the setup and the takedown and much cleaner. Come here knowing that it is a very bear aware site and no food in your tents, which is normal for the area; it's a bit of a pain but understandable. The staff is very friendly and helpful. However, if you're a light sleeper, trains, other tent zippers, dogs, conversations, traffic, and early birds can be an issue. There are fun activities and its close to Glacier Park. So use the ear plugs and hone your stove fire starting skills (gets cold at night!) and you will be fine."

"It’s a great property, but just be aware that at least on the first floor, you can hear everything. It’s an old building, and you can hear noise from guests in the hall as well as the train across the road. On the other hand, the beds were great and the atmosphere was terrific."
